Description

The Southwest Florida Fertility Center is situated in Fort Myers and directed by Dr. Jacob L. Glock.

This fertility center offers all reproductive standard procedures such as IVF/ICSI and IUI as well as third-party reproduction by means of sperm and egg donation. Before undergoing any fertility treatments, patients will be exhaustively examined in order to detect the origin of their infertility issues.

The reviews about Southwest Florida Fertility Center found on the internet are both positive and negative. Below, we will show some of the comments made on Google Business Review.

According to Ashley, Dr. Glock and his staff make their patients feel like home. She had a successful treatment and would recommend this clinic to anyone. Also, patient Elialina was able to become a mother thanks to Southwest Florida Fertility Center.

However, there are also some negative comments. On the one hand, user Jet describes the receptionists as rude. On the other hand, Jessica asked a question and the staff couldn't answer it.
